在Ubuntu上搭建L2TP VPN服务,可便捷地实现远程访问和数据安全。只需简单配置,即可享受稳定的连接,保障远程办公和数据传输的安全性。
随着互联网的普及,越来越多的用户需要远程访问公司内部网络、国外网站或者使用代理服务器来保护个人隐私,本文将为您介绍如何在Ubuntu服务器上搭建L2TP VPN服务,实现远程访问与安全连接。
准备工作
1、一台Ubuntu服务器(推荐使用Ubuntu 18.04或更高版本)
2、一台能够连接到互联网的路由器或交换机
3、一定的Linux操作系统知识
安装L2TP VPN服务
1、更新系统软件包
登录到Ubuntu服务器,更新系统软件包:
sudo apt update sudo apt upgrade
2、安装L2TP VPN服务
安装L2TP VPN服务所需的软件包:
sudo apt install strongswan
3、配置L2TP VPN服务
编辑/etc/ipsec.conf
文件,添加以下内容:
config setup charondebug="ike 2, knl 2, cfg 2, net 2, esp 2, dmn 2, auth 2" conn %default ikelifetime=60m keylife=20m rekeymargin=3m keyingtries=1 conn L2TP-IPsec left=%defaultroute leftsubnet=0.0.0.0/0 leftauth=psk leftsubnet=192.168.1.0/24 right=%any rightdns=8.8.8.8,8.8.4.4 rightsourceip=%config auto=add
4、配置预共享密钥
编辑/etc/ipsec.secrets
文件,添加以下内容:
: PSK "your_pre_shared_key"
将your_pre_shared_key
替换为您希望使用的预共享密钥。
5、重启L2TP VPN服务
重启L2TP VPN服务以使配置生效:
sudo systemctl restart strongswan
客户端连接
1、在客户端设备上安装L2TP VPN客户端
以Windows为例,您可以在微软商店搜索并安装L2TP VPN客户端。
2、连接L2TP VPN
在客户端设备上,打开L2TP VPN客户端,填写以下信息:
- VPN服务器地址:Ubuntu服务器的公网IP地址
- 用户名:您在Ubuntu服务器上创建的VPN用户名
- 密码:您在Ubuntu服务器上创建的VPN密码
- 预共享密钥:在步骤4中配置的预共享密钥
连接后,您就可以通过L2TP VPN服务访问远程网络了。
安全提示
1、为了提高安全性,请确保您的Ubuntu服务器安装了最新的安全补丁。
2、在配置L2TP VPN服务时,请使用强密码和预共享密钥,避免泄露。
3、如果您需要访问敏感数据,建议使用SSH等安全协议进行远程连接。
通过在Ubuntu服务器上搭建L2TP VPN服务,您可以轻松实现远程访问与安全连接,本文为您介绍了搭建过程,希望能对您有所帮助,在搭建过程中,请确保遵循安全提示,以确保您的网络环境安全。
未经允许不得转载! 作者:烟雨楼,转载或复制请以超链接形式并注明出处快连vpn。
原文地址:https://le-tsvpn.com/vpnpingce/65129.html发布于:2024-11-14
还没有评论,来说两句吧...